Monday morning accident in front of Hoffer’s Drive In

A two vehicle accident in front of Hoffer’s Drive In on Monday morning sent two individuals to the hospital with minor injuries.

According to a report from the Hallettsville Police Department, the accident took place around 7:55 a.m. on Monday in the 100 block of W. Fairwinds.

The report said a gray Mercury Mariner, driven by Ricky Mitchell, 67, of Hallettsville, was traveling in the westbound lane when he attempted to turn left into the Hoffer’s Drive-In parking lot and failed to yield the right-of-way colliding with a white Dodge Grand Caravan that was traveling east.

The Grand Caravan was driven by Tim Hotz, 44, of Hallettsville, who also had two minor passengers in the vehicle.

Hotz and a passenger of of the Dodge Grand Caravan reported to the officer they had injuries and were transported to Lavaca Medical Center by the Lavaca County EMS.

Both vehicles were towed away from the scene of the accident.
